Electronic features of Gaussian quantum well as depending on the parameters

Abstract

In this study, the electronic characteristics of Gaussian quantum well have been examined as dependent on the parameters such as the concentration ratio, the even power parameter and Gaussian potential range. The energy levels and the wave functions in Gaussian quantum well (GQW) under effective mass approach were concluded by Schrödinger equation solution. According to our results, all parameters have a great impact on the electronic characteristics of GQW. These characteristics have practical interest in the design of adjustable semiconductor devices using such structures.
